The Dragon's Dilemma: A Lyrical Love Triangle

The moon cast a silver glow over the ancient city of Drakonis, its towers reaching into the night sky, shrouded in mist and mystery. In the heart of this city, where the dragon shifters roamed freely, there was a tale that whispered through the cobblestone streets, a tale of love, fate, and the unyielding power of destiny.

Elian, a noble dragon shifter with scales as dark as the night and eyes that held the weight of the world, had always known that his heart belonged to no one but Liora, a human who had wandered into his life like a dream. Liora, with her fiery spirit and heart as pure as the crystal-clear streams that wound through Drakonis, had found solace in the arms of the dragon who could not show his true form.

But the fates had woven a more complex tapestry. A prophecy, long forgotten, now came to life, whispering of a dragon shifter destined to bring peace to Drakonis—a dragon whose name was Aiden, a dragon whose presence could either unite or tear the realm apart.

As the night deepened, the three of them stood at the precipice of a love triangle that could change the very fabric of their existence.

Elian's voice was a mere whisper, but it cut through the silence like a blade, "Liora, I have loved you since the day I first saw you, my heart has known no other."

Liora's eyes, once full of passion, now shimmered with the weight of a heavy truth, "Elian, I am yours, but I am also a human. The prophecy... it speaks of a destiny that I must embrace, a destiny that I cannot ignore."

Aiden, who had been silent, stepped forward, his eyes reflecting the moonlight, "I have come to this place to claim my destiny, to be the dragon that will unite this land. But I also feel the pull of your love, Liora. The choice is yours, and mine."

The air was thick with tension, the stars above seemed to hold their breath as the three of them stood in the quiet night, their lives entwined in a dance of love, loyalty, and fate.

Liora's heart was heavy, torn between two worlds, two loves. She knew that her decision would echo through the ages, her choice forever etched into the annals of Drakonis's history.

"I have to choose," she said, her voice breaking the silence, "but I cannot choose between you. The prophecy is clear, and I must embrace it. But before I go, I need to know if my heart will ever belong to another."

Elian's eyes softened, a tear escaping, "Liora, you are the light in my dark world. My love for you is unwavering, and I will wait for you, as long as it takes."

Aiden's eyes met hers, "Liora, if you choose to walk the path of destiny, know that I will support you. But I also promise you that you will never be alone."

With a deep breath, Liora made her decision, her voice strong and clear, "Then I choose the prophecy, the destiny that has been set before me. But know this, my loves, I carry the weight of your hearts within me."

The next morning, as the sun rose over Drakonis, casting its golden light over the city, Liora left for the mountains, to fulfill her destiny as the chosen one of the prophecy. Elian and Aiden, though hearts aching, watched her go, knowing that love, in all its forms, would forever bind them together.

The Dragon's Dilemma had only just begun, but the love that bloomed between Elian, Liora, and Aiden would endure, a testament to the strength of the human spirit and the enduring power of love in the face of destiny.
